How to add a sound at the end of the bruteforce

Been asked in PVT this question and I thought may be usefull for the other users too

Just download and install this little exe
http://www.mustang.co.za/exe/PlaySoundSetup.exe
once installed copy playsound.exe and tada.wav (you can find it in c:\windows\media) in the oclhashcat-lite folder
after each bf-line add the command
playsound tada.wav
job done
